BEIJING, Feb 16, Anatoly Samokhvalov. Russian figure skater Kamila Valieva demonstrated an unmistakable skate free skate at the 2022 Olympics afternoon practice. On Tuesday, Valieva won the short program at the Beijing Olympics. On Wednesday afternoon, she showed a clean free skate with two quadruple toe loops, a Salchow and a triple Axel. The International Doping Testing Agency (ITA) on Friday reported that Valieva’s doping test of December 25, 2021 tested positive for trimetazidine. The Court of Arbitration for Sport (CAS), despite the appeals of the International Olympic Committee (IOC), the International Skating Union (ISU) and the World Anti-Doping Agency (WADA), allowed Valieva to the personal tournament of the Games in Beijing. However, the IOC stated that if Valieva gets on the podium, the awards ceremony will not be held, and the results of the tournament themselves will be preliminary.
